The "Traverse Guide" is a component used in the yarn winding process of synthetic fibers, the temporary twisting process, and the rewinding process of natural fibers. It moves the yarn to prevent it from becoming uneven when winding yarn onto a bobbin. We handle two types mainly used in the spinning process: the "Cam Traverse Guide" and "Traverse Speed." Our company produces high-quality yarn path products by molding both ceramic and resin components using our own manufactured molds. This not only allows for handling yarn at higher speeds but also reduces the frequency of product replacements, resulting in excellent cost performance. 【Features】 ■ Cam Traverse Guide - A ceramic holder guides the path of the yarn, while the resin part is fixed to a metal cam, which rotates to move in a consistent rhythm. ■ Traverse Speed - Made of ceramic, it ensures high durability and smooth yarn guiding performance, enabling stable winding. *For more details, please refer to the related links or feel free to contact us.

In 1924, we founded "Yuasa Shoten," which manufactures and sells yarn guides for textile machinery. Later, in 1963, we established "Yuasa Yarn Guide Industry Co., Ltd." as the manufacturing division for hard chrome-plated yarn guides. Today, we develop, manufacture, and sell yarn guides and devices that are used not only in textile machinery such as weaving machines but also in electrical machinery such as winding machines.
